On February 24, 2022, Russia launched a full-scale invasion of Ukraine. A 21-year-old Russian prisoner of war will face trial in a Ukrainian court, accused of killing two civilians in the Kharkiv region.
In front of the Ukrainian court - real, not in absentia - there will be a Russian who shot down the civilian residents of Kharkivshkin in October 2024. Ukrainian defenders have taken the figure prisoner as a survivor during the fighting in the Kupyan direction, as reported by the Security Service of Ukraine in the official telegram channel. This was reported by the press service of the SBU. In October 2024, Russian Artem Kulikov shot two civilians in Kupyan district of Kharkiv region. Together with an accomplice, he tortured men, demanding to provide information about the locations of Ukrainian servicemen, and then, without receiving information, shot them close by with a machine gun.
